Making the robot feel pain means seeking feedback from it. The response that a human gives during acute pain is involuntary. For example, the prick of a needle, the feeling of pain on touching a hot object, remove the hand immediately.
Fear is also associated with the experience of pain. Many people do not want to take injections due to fear of pain. If even a robot starts to fear, how will he complete the task given to him?
